FLIGHT
Okay, this is a big one! Never set your heart on a specific date when planning a trip to Vegas! Flight pricess range from $100-$1000+ round trip depending on airline, date, etc. On my recent trip, we paid $129 round trip from OKC. Every other flight option within the month was $350+. EVENTS
Getting in to a pool party, dayclub, nightclub, etc. usually costs around $100 justy for the entry fee. Do not pay to get in anywhere! There ar club promoters everywhere in Vegas that get paid to fill their guest lists. They will gladly put you on their vip list for free entry! I have met plenty over my visits. This last time, I messaged them before my trip ad asked what events would be going on during my stay, they sent me a list, I responded with what I was interested in, and boom.. free entry! FOOD
I like to splurge on a few nice meals while in Vegas and then eat cheap the rest of the time. Food isn't really an issue in Vegas, as any price range is available. I would recommend Wahlburgersas far as something inexpensive because, well I love Mark Wahlberg. Also some locals told us about the $9.99 "steak special" at Ellis Island. This place is old and not fancy at all, but you get a salad, baked potatoe, and a really good steak for $9.99 LOL. We were all pretty shocked at how good it was.
DRINKS
Everyone knows you get free drinks while gambling. Lets be real though, theres like 1 cocktail waitress working the entire casino floor and it takes forever to get a drink sometimes. Also, some of us aren't huge gamblers! My advice: go to the casino bar, play video poker or blackjack on the bar top. When you put in a minimum of $20, it notifies the bartender and you get free drinks. Don't forget to tip! You get much faster service and I only bet like 30 cents at a time so I haver never lost money; usually break even or win a couple dollars!
